Services
Broward Health Maternity provides 24/7 ground and air transportation for urgent care you may need to arrive at the hospital. Specialists are always in-house for any of your or your baby’s urgent needs. Certified midwives, obstetricians, neonatologists, and anesthesiologists are always at the hospital for immediate care. The facility has 36 private postpartum suite-sized rooms with large showers and a vanity station. They have three deluxe suites available on a first-come, first-served basis for an additional charge. The deluxe rooms include more space for family members and a tea-time service.
While resting with your new baby, you can watch their dedicated Newborn Channel for information on how to care for your newborn and yourself postpartum. Specialty
Broward Health Maternity’s fetal medicine specializes in high-risk pregnancies. Broward Health Maternity has one of the largest Neonatal Intensive Care Units in Florida. The 63-bed unit is a Level III Regional Care Unit providing care to the most delicate babies born. After birth, they conduct weekly parent support groups to connect with other parents and receive evidence-based healthcare information. Breastfeeding classes are available for expecting and new mothers. The information includes proper positioning, challenges you may face, and up-to-date topics on breastfeeding. After birth, you can utilize their breast pump rentals on-site, which are available at any time. Lactation Consultants are available during business hours to assist you in person or via phone for any breastfeeding questions or concerns. The center partners with Mother’s Milk Bank of Florida to provide breastmilk to any infant in need.
